CALOOCAN — The University of Caloocan City (UCC) – College of Law celebrated a significant milestone as 16 of its graduates successfully passed the 2025 Bar Examinations. Achieving a 72.7% passing rate with 16 out of 22 examinees qualifying, the institution reaffirmed its commitment to academic excellence and the development of ethical legal professionals.
